diff --git a/.gitignore b/.gitignore index dfe67d8..3dcaea3 100644 --- a/.gitignore +++ b/.gitignore @@ -22,3 +22,4 @@ /groonga-2.0.4.tar.gz /groonga-2.0.5.tar.gz /groonga-2.0.9.tar.gz +/groonga-3.0.2.tar.gz diff --git a/groonga.spec b/groonga.spec index f73b702..2a23efd 100644 --- a/groonga.spec +++ b/groonga.spec @@ -1,8 +1,9 @@ %global php_extdir %(php-config --extension-dir 2>/dev/null || echo "undefined") +%global __provides_exclude_from ^(%{python_sitelib}/.*\\.so|%{php_extdir}/.*\\.so)$ Name: groonga -Version: 2.0.9 -Release: 2%{?dist} +Version: 3.0.2 +Release: 0%{?dist} Summary: An Embeddable Fulltext Search Engine Group: Applications/Text @@ -128,7 +129,7 @@ Group: Applications/Text Requires: %{name}-libs = %{version}-%{release} %description plugin-suggest -Sugget plugin for groonga +Suggest plugin for groonga %package munin-plugins Summary: Munin plugins for groonga @@ -198,7 +199,6 @@ make %{?_smp_mflags} %install -rm -rf $RPM_BUILD_ROOT make install DESTDIR=$RPM_BUILD_ROOT INSTALL="install -p" rm $RPM_BUILD_ROOT%{_libdir}/groonga/plugins/*/*.la rm $RPM_BUILD_ROOT%{_libdir}/*.la @@ -276,6 +276,15 @@ exit 0 %postun server-http %systemd_postun groonga-server-http.service +%post server-gqtp +%systemd_post groonga-server-gqtp.service + +%preun server-gqtp +%systemd_preun groonga-server-gqtp.service + +%postun server-gqtp +%systemd_postun groonga-server-gqtp.service + %post httpd %systemd_post groonga-httpd.service @@ -314,7 +323,8 @@ fi %{_libdir}/*.so.* %dir %{_libdir}/groonga %dir %{_libdir}/groonga/plugins -%dir %{_libdir}/groonga/plugins/tokenizers +%dir %{_libdir}/groonga/plugins/table +%dir %{_libdir}/groonga/plugins/query_expanders %{_libdir}/groonga/plugins/table/table.so %{_libdir}/groonga/plugins/query_expanders/tsv.so %{_datadir}/groonga/ @@ -360,12 +370,13 @@ fi %files tokenizer-mecab %defattr(-,root,root,-) +%dir %{_libdir}/groonga/plugins/tokenizers %{_libdir}/groonga/plugins/tokenizers/mecab.so %files plugin-suggest %defattr(-,root,root,-) +%dir %{_libdir}/groonga/plugins/suggest %{_bindir}/groonga-suggest-* -%dir %{_libdir}/groonga/plugins %{_libdir}/groonga/plugins/suggest/suggest.so %files munin-plugins @@ -382,6 +393,12 @@ fi %{php_extdir}/groonga.so %changelog +* Fri Mar 29 2013 HAYASHI Kentaro - 3.0.2-0 +- new upstream release. +- fix wrong directory ownership. +- filter not to export private modules. +- add missing groonga-server-gqtp related systemd macros. + * Thu Feb 14 2013 Fedora Release Engineering - 2.0.9-2 - Rebuilt for https://fedoraproject.org/wiki/Fedora_19_Mass_Rebuild diff --git a/sources b/sources index 4fe78c5..4f187fb 100644 --- a/sources +++ b/sources @@ -1 +1 @@ -70171632e7d2b4133b03237847b7108c groonga-2.0.9.tar.gz +b17934ef2589a4e261ed0d99aec713eb groonga-3.0.2.tar.gz